Season Overview
The 2006-07 season saw Club América, under manager Luis Fernando Tena, achieve significant results across various competitions. The club finished 2nd in the Liga MX Apertura regular season and 1st in the Primera Clausura regular season. América also reached the final of the InterLiga and secured a third-place play-off finish in the Club World Cup. Notably, the club had won the CONCACAF Champions League in 2006, preceding the start of this season.
Key Players
The squad featured prominent talents such as Paraguayan striker Salvador Cabañas, who was a key attacking force. Other notable players included Mexican international goalkeeper Guillermo Ochoa, experienced defender Duilio Davino, and midfield stalwart Germán Villa. Argentine forward Claudio López and Mexican icon Cuauhtémoc Blanco also played significant roles for the team during this period.
